Understanding Your Mammogram Results: What Does BI-RADS Mean?
BI-RADS (Breast Imaging Reporting and Data System) is a standardized scoring system (Categories 0–6) used by radiologists to describe mammogram findings and guide follow-up care. A BI-RADS category is not a breast cancer diagnosis or cancer stage. Most results (BI-RADS 1–3) indicate normal or likely benign findings, while higher categories (BI-RADS 4–5) recommend a tissue biopsy to rule out malignancy.
 

What is BI-RADS?
According to the American College of Radiology (ACR), BI-RADS stands for Breast Imaging Reporting and Data System. It provides standardized terminology and assessment categories for mammography, breast ultrasound and breast MRI.
Each examination receives an assessment category that communicates how concerning a finding appears and whether routine screening, additional imaging, short-term follow-up or biopsy may be appropriate.
 

What do BI-RADS categories 0–6 mean?
Radiologists assign a specific BI-RADS category based on visual features in your scan. The table below outlines what each category means, the estimated likelihood of cancer, and typical next steps:
 
BI-RADS category What it means Estimated likelihood of malignancy Typical next step What patients should know
BI-RADS 0 – Incomplete The examination cannot yet receive a final assessment because more information is needed. Not assigned Additional mammogram views, breast ultrasound and/or comparison with previous imaging BI-RADS 0 does not mean cancer. A final category is usually assigned after further evaluation.
BI-RADS 1 –Negative No suspicious abnormality is identified. No suspicious finding identified Routine breast screening according to age, risk and medical recommendations This is a normal imaging assessment.
BI-RADS 2 – Benign A clearly noncancerous finding is present, such as certain cysts or benign calcifications. Essentially benign Routine screening The finding is documented but does not have suspicious imaging characteristics.
BI-RADS 3 – Probably benign The finding is very likely benign but should be monitored to confirm stability. ≤2% Short-interval follow-up imaging, often beginning at about six months Follow-up is important because stability over time supports a benign assessment.
BI-RADS 4 – Suspicious The finding has enough suspicious features that tissue diagnosis is generally recommended. >2% to <95% Image-guided biopsy is generally recommended BI-RADS 4 does not confirm cancer. The category covers a broad range of risk and may be divided into 4A, 4B and 4C.
BI-RADS 4A – Low suspicion Mildly suspicious imaging features >2% to 10% Biopsy generally recommended Most findings in this category will still prove benign, but tissue diagnosis is usually needed.
BI-RADS 4B – Moderate suspicion Imaging features raise an intermediate level of concern >10% to 50% Biopsy generally recommended Pathology is needed to determine whether the finding is benign or malignant.
BI-RADS 4C – High suspicion Imaging features are substantially concerning but do not meet BI-RADS 5 criteria >50% to <95% Biopsy strongly indicated The probability of cancer is higher, but only tissue diagnosis can confirm malignancy.
BI-RADS 5 – Highly suggestive of malignancy Imaging findings have classic or highly concerning features for cancer. ≥95% Biopsy and appropriate clinical action Cancer is highly suspected, but biopsy is still required to establish the diagnosis.
BI-RADS 6 – Known biopsy-proven malignancy Cancer has already been confirmed by tissue diagnosis. Malignancy already confirmed Imaging may support treatment planning and assessment This category is used for a cancer that has already been diagnosed, not for estimating whether cancer is present.
 

What happens after an abnormal mammogram?
An abnormal mammogram does not automatically mean breast cancer. The next step depends on the BI-RADS category, the specific imaging finding and your individual risk factors.
 
Further evaluation may include:
  • Additional diagnostic mammogram views
  • Breast ultrasound
  • Breast MRI in selected situations
  • Comparison with previous breast imaging
  • Image-guided core needle biopsy when tissue diagnosis is needed
Your medical team may also consider breast density, symptoms, age, family history, personal medical history and previous imaging before recommending further investigation.
 

Is BI-RADS the Same as Breast Density?
No. BI-RADS assessment categories and breast density describe different aspects of a mammogram.
 
  • BI-RADS category: Describes the radiologist’s assessment of specific imaging findings and helps determine the appropriate next step, such as routine screening, additional imaging, follow-up or biopsy.
  • Breast density: Describes the proportion of fibrous and glandular tissue compared with fatty tissue in the breast.
 
Breast density is classified into four categories:
  • A: Almost entirely fatty
  • B: Scattered areas of fibroglandular density
  • C: Heterogeneously dense
  • D: Extremely dense
 
Dense breast tissue can make some abnormalities more difficult to detect on mammography. Breast density may therefore be considered together with age, family history and other breast cancer risk factors when determining an individualized screening approach.

Frequently Asked Questions

Does BI-RADS 3 mean cancer?
No. BI-RADS 3 means a finding is probably benign, with no more than a 2% likelihood of malignancy. Follow-up imaging is typically recommended to confirm that the finding remains stable.
 
Does BI-RADS 4 mean I have breast cancer?
No. BI-RADS 4 means the finding is suspicious enough that a biopsy is generally recommended. The biopsy determines whether the tissue is benign or malignant.
 
Which BI-RADS categories usually require a biopsy?
BI-RADS 4 and BI-RADS 5 findings generally require biopsy or other appropriate diagnostic action. BI-RADS 4 represents a suspicious finding, while BI-RADS 5 is highly suggestive of malignancy.
 
Can a BI-RADS category change after additional imaging?
Yes. BI-RADS 0 means the assessment is incomplete. After additional mammogram views, ultrasound or comparison with previous images, the radiologist can assign a final BI-RADS category.
 
Is BI-RADS a breast cancer stage?
No. BI-RADS describes breast imaging findings and recommended next steps. Breast cancer staging is performed only after cancer has been diagnosed.
Understanding your BI-RADS mammogram result can make the report easier to interpret. Rather than viewing the number as a diagnosis, think of it as a standardized guide that helps you and your healthcare team decide what should happen next.
